im 5,9 150 and rde the cattalyst 112, it really depends what type of stuff your gonna be doing. If ur just learning go with one a bit bigger cause it will progress you faster and make the basics easier to learn. Or if you already have some skills and want to focus on more wake to wake stuff get the big one but if u like tech stuff like slides and shuv combos ect then get the smaller one. I myself love the catalyst for its finless riding ability, it tracks super well without fins and you can haul ass into the wake with ease and it just make doing alot of tech stuff a little easier when you dont have a fin to get caught up on. Itll just take you a little longer to learn to land stuff cause the fin wount grab u in as much.
